Costa del Sol Airport (Spanish: Aeropuerto Costa del Sol), (ICAO: SCSO) is an airport serving communities on the west shore of Rapel Lake in the O'Higgins Region of Chile. The airport is 10 kilometres (6.2 mi) upstream of the Rapel Dam.

There is rising terrain north through east. The southeast end of the runway is 140 metres (460 ft) from the water, which is 40 metres (130 ft) lower.
